Подтвердить что ты не робот

Найти неиспользуемые публичные функции

Есть ли способ автоматически найти все неиспользованные публичные функции в решении? У меня есть resharper, и прямо сейчас я должен сделать "найти обычаи" на каждом символе, который является утомительным - кажется, что должен быть лучший способ

4b9b3361

Ответ 1

Конечно, лучший способ. Вот что вы должны сделать, если используете ReSharper 4.5 или новее:

  • Перейдите в ReSharper > Параметры > Проверка кодa > Уровень проверки.
  • Прокрутите страницу до категории "Неиспользуемые символы" и установите все содержащиеся элементы, называемые "Неединственная доступность", которые будут показаны - отображаются ли они как подсказки, предупреждения или предложения, не релевантны и полностью зависят от вас.
  • В ReSharper > Параметры > Проверка кодa > Настройки выберите "Анализ ошибок в целом решении". Нажмите OK, чтобы применить изменения в параметрах ReSharper.
  • Щелкните правой кнопкой мыши решение node в обозревателе решений и выберите "Найти проблемы с кодом". ReSharper отобразит различные проблемы с кодом, которые он обнаруживает в вашем решении в окне инструмента "Результаты проверки". В частности, в разделе "Неиспользуемые символы" вы увидите все неличные типы и члены вашего кода, которые не используются.